Global Polypropylene Market Overview

  • The Global Polypropylene Market is valued at USD 85 billion,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for lightweight and durable materials in various industries, including packaging, automotive, and construction. The versatility of polypropylene, along with its cost-effectiveness, has made it a preferred choice for manufacturers looking to enhance product performance while reducing costs.
  • Key players in this market include the United States, China, and Germany; China leads on capacity and consumption within Asia, the United States benefits from integrated petrochemical infrastructure and sizable automotive, packaging, and consumer sectors, while Germany’s engineering and automotive base sustains high-grade polypropylene demand.
  • In 2023, the European Union implemented regulations aimed at reducing plastic waste, which includes measures to promote the recycling of polypropylene. This regulation mandates that by 2025, all plastic packaging in the EU must be recyclable or reusable, significantly impacting the production and consumption patterns of polypropylene in the region.

By Type:The polypropylene market is segmented into various types, including Homopolymer (PP-H), Random Copolymer (PP-R), Impact Copolymer/Block Copolymer (PP-B/ICP), Thermoplastic Polyolefin (TPO), and Compounded/Recycled PP. Each type serves different applications and industries, with specific properties that cater to diverse consumer needs. Homopolymers typically offer higher stiffness and clarity for fibers, films, and injection-molded parts, while copolymers (random and impact) provide improved impact strength and toughness suited to automotive, packaging, and appliances; TPOs blend PP with elastomers for improved flexibility in automotive exteriors and roofing; compounded and recycled PP support performance tailoring and circularity goals.

By Application:The applications of polypropylene are diverse, including Injection Molding, Film & Sheet, Fiber & Raffia, Blow Molding, and Extrusion Coating & Pipe. Each application utilizes specific properties of polypropylene to meet industry standards and consumer demands. Injection molding leverages PP’s melt flow and toughness for automotive interiors, appliances, caps/closures, and consumer goods; film and sheet use PP’s moisture resistance and stiffness for flexible packaging and labeling; fiber and raffia employ PP’s low density and strength in woven bags and nonwovens; blow molding supports containers and automotive ducts; extrusion coating and pipe applications benefit from chemical resistance and weldability.

Global Polypropylene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increasing Demand from Packaging Industry:The global packaging industry is projected to reach $1.2 trillion in future, with polypropylene accounting for a significant share due to its lightweight and durable properties. In future, the demand for polypropylene in packaging applications was approximately 20 million tons, driven by the rise in e-commerce and consumer goods. This trend is expected to continue, as companies increasingly prefer polypropylene for its versatility and cost-effectiveness in packaging solutions.
  • Rising Use in Automotive Applications:The automotive sector is increasingly adopting polypropylene for its lightweight characteristics, contributing to fuel efficiency. In future, around 4.5 million tons of polypropylene were utilized in automotive manufacturing. With the global automotive market projected to grow to $3.5 trillion in future, the demand for polypropylene in this sector is expected to rise, driven by the need for sustainable and efficient materials in vehicle production.
  • Growth in Construction Sector:The construction industry is anticipated to grow to $10 trillion in future, with polypropylene playing a crucial role in various applications such as insulation, piping, and flooring. In future, the consumption of polypropylene in construction reached approximately 3 million tons. This growth is fueled by urbanization and infrastructure development, particularly in emerging markets, where the demand for durable and cost-effective construction materials is surging.

Market Challenges

  • Volatility in Raw Material Prices:The polypropylene market faces significant challenges due to f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ly propylene. In future, propylene prices varied between $800 and $1,200 per ton, impacting production costs. This volatility can lead to unpredictable pricing for end products, making it difficult for manufacturers to maintain profit margins and plan for future investments, ultimately affecting market stability.
  • Environmental Concerns and Regulations:Increasing environmental regulations are posing challenges for the polypropylene market. In future, over 50 countries implemented stricter regulations on plastic waste management, affecting production processes. The global push for sustainability is leading to higher compliance costs for manufacturers, as they must invest in eco-friendly practices and technologies to meet these regulations, which can hinder growth and profitability.
